Man, 102, in 'critical condition' after alleged assault at pub

A 102-year-old man is in a critical condition in hospital after allegedly being assaulted at a pub in South Wales.

Emergency services were called to reports of an assault at The Crow's Nest in Cwmbran at about 10.25pm on 1 August and the man was taken to hospital.

A 56-year-old man from Llanelli was arrested on suspicion of section 20 assault and has since been released under investigation.

Gwent Police are appealing for witnesses and want to speak to anyone who was in the pub between 10pm and 11pm on the night of the incident.

A spokesman said: "Gwent Police is appealing for witnesses following a report of an assault at The Crow's Nest pub in Cwmbran at about 10.25pm on Saturday 1 August.

"Officers attended along with crews from the Welsh Ambulance Service and a 102-year-old man was taken to hospital for treatment. He remains in critical condition.

"A 56-year-old man from Llanelli was arrested on suspicion of Section 20 assault and has since been released under investigation."
